A patient taking lithium complains of increased thirst and frequent urination. What condition

should the PMHNP suspect?

A. Hypothyroidism


✔✔B. Diabetes insipidus


C. Hyponatremia

D. Neuroleptic malignant syndrome




Which neurotransmitter is primarily involved in anxiety disorders?


✔✔A. GABA


B. Dopamine

C. Glutamate

D. Acetylcholine




A 10-year-old boy has difficulty paying attention, interrupts others, and has trouble staying

seated. What is the most likely diagnosis?



1

,A. Autism Spectrum Disorder


✔✔B. ADHD


C. Conduct Disorder

D. Oppositional Defiant Disorder




Which class of medication is first-line for treating panic disorder?

A. Antipsychotics


✔✔B. SSRIs


C. Mood stabilizers

D. Stimulants




A client on clozapine presents with fever, sore throat, and malaise. What lab value is most urgent

to assess?

A. Platelets


✔✔B. Absolute neutrophil count


C. Hemoglobin

D. Blood glucose




2

,What is the mechanism of action of SSRIs?


✔✔A. Inhibit reuptake of serotonin


B. Block dopamine receptors

C. Enhance GABA activity

D. Inhibit MAO-A enzyme




In treating PTSD, which therapeutic approach focuses on gradually exposing the client to

trauma-related cues?


✔✔A. Prolonged exposure therapy


B. Supportive therapy

C. Psychoanalysis

D. Solution-focused therapy




A patient with bipolar I disorder is experiencing mania. Which medication is most appropriate?

A. Sertraline


✔✔B. Lithium


C. Diazepam

D. Donepezil


3

, A 14-year-old is defiant toward authority, frequently loses temper, and blames others for

mistakes. What is the diagnosis?


✔✔A. Oppositional Defiant Disorder


B. Conduct Disorder

C. ADHD

D. Bipolar Disorder




Which lab should be monitored regularly for a patient on valproic acid?


✔✔A. Liver function tests


B. Hemoglobin A1c

C. BUN

D. Amylase
